It seems that Samsung might join the gaming smartphone race with their own gaming smartphone device based on a statement made by @MMDDJ_ on Twitter. If my predictions are correct, the smartphone will follow the footsteps of other gaming smartphones such as the Razer Phone, Xiaomi Black Shark, and even the ASUS ROG Phone in that it might feature the Qualcomm Snapdragon 845 chipset, high ram capacity, probably a high refresh-rate infinity display and equally large battery capacity.

On another note, the upcoming bendable Samsung device will not be called the Samsung Galaxy X which raises the question, what is the Samsung Galaxy X? We’ll find out more about the device during CES2019 next year. All statement made by @MMDDJ_ is not backed up by solid evidence to take every bit of information with a heaping scoop of salt and stay tuned to TechNave.com for more updates.
